Latham, New York – Earl B. Feiden Appliances has been included in the New York State Historic Business Preservation Registry, a recognition formalized during a ceremony on August 26, 2025. The family-owned appliance retailer, founded in 1926, has been a staple in the community for nearly a century, providing services and support to local residents.
The recognition underscores Earl B. Feiden’s long-term commitment to the community. An employee pointed out that the business has always prioritized serving customers, especially those in need of essential appliance services. The event celebrating the accolade featured a flagpole dedication honoring former owner Earl B. Feiden Jr., a World War II veteran, who played a significant role in establishing the store’s reputation and commitment to quality service.
The press conference took place at the Earl B. Feiden Appliance showroom in Latham, where several dignitaries were present, including Albany County Executive Daniel McCoy and representatives from the Capital Region Chamber and the Albany County Honor-A-Vet Committee. Senator Jake Ashby was instrumental in advancing the nomination for the historical registry, emphasizing the business’s contributions to the Latham community.
